Not only can a dirty roofing wreck your home's curb appeal, but it can in fact damage your roof. That's why it is very important to keep your roof covering tidy. Your roofing system is subjected to the elements all the time, everyday. Dirt and also particles will accumulate on it. Natural rainfall is normally sufficient to wash off the look of many dirt.


Black stains are called gloeocapsa lava or GM. GM algae is a bacterium that feeds off of both asphalt and also limestone roofing in wet, trendy as well as shaded locations of the roofing. When there is very little light, GM forms a green color. The even more shaded areas of the roofing are most likely to have these algae, which can nurture various sorts of mold and mildews.



A record by the Asphalt Roof Manufacturing Organization (ARMA) notes that these algae spores are moved by wind or pets. They can promptly spread from rooftop to roof in areas of single family homes, townhomes and also apartment or condo complicateds (Roof Washing). Lichens are basically the mix of algae and fungus. ARMA describes lichens as fungi that grow symbiotically with algae.

Unlike the algae and also lichens, moss is an actual plant. Moss has a superficial root system and also requires a lot of dampness to survive.

The spots and development spots triggered by algae, fungi and moss can damage your roof through roof shingles wear and tear and also timber rot. Both lead to expensive fixings as well as can reduce the life of your roof.

According to ARMA, roofing systems with algae stains absorb warm. Lichen colonies can be fairly destructive to tiles.

Moss can cause the sides of the shingles to raise or crinklefrequently the first sign that a roofing system replacement is required. And also since moss holds in dampness, it can freeze in the wintertime, triggering a lot more roof shingles damage. Moss has the capability to hold in dampness and divert water, which makes your roofing deck prone to wood rot as well as leaks.
